Our verdict is Likely benign. Variant got -4 ACMG points: 0P and 4B. BS2

The NM_001460.5(FMO2):​c.745C>T​(p.Arg249Ter) variant causes a stop gained change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000969 in 1,613,638 control chromosomes in the GnomAD database, including 12 homozygotes.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Variant results in nonsense mediated mRNA decay.

Genes affected
FMO2 (HGNC:3770): (flavin containing dimethylaniline monoxygenase 2) This gene encodes a flavin-containing monooxygenase family member. It is an NADPH-dependent enzyme that catalyzes the N-oxidation of some primary alkylamines through an N-hydroxylamine intermediate. However, some human populations contain an allele (FMO2*2A) with a premature stop codon, resulting in a protein that is C-terminally-truncated, has no catalytic activity, and is likely degraded rapidly. This gene is found in a cluster with other related family members on chromosome 1.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Aug 2014]
